Re: Head studs

Re cleaning threads with a die nut - I was in the habit of doing this until I was advised die nuts are a bit too aggressive, and proper chaser items should be used. Lang do an excellent set of imperial tap and die chasers in UNF and UNC.

Re: Front wheel bearings question

I worked in a brake workshop in another life, and when we found signs of inner race rotation was advised to apply a couple of dimples to the area with a centre punch, just enough to require tapping the inner race home on the axle.
